How does programmable sound generator work?

A programmable sound generator, or PSG, is a sound chip that generates sound waves by synthesizing multiple basic waveforms, and often some kind of noise generator (all controlled by writing data to dedicated registers in the sound chip, hence the name) and combining and mixing these waveforms into a complex waveform.

How does NES sound work?

The NES palette is based on NTSC rather than RGB values. The stock NES supports a total of five sound channels, two of which are pulse channels with 4 pulse width settings, one is a triangle wave generator, another is a noise generator (often used for percussion), and the fifth one plays low-quality digital samples.

How do Soundchips work?

A sound chip is an integrated circuit (chip) designed to produce audio signals through digital, analog or mixed-mode electronics. Sound chips are typically fabricated on metal–oxide–semiconductor (MOS) mixed-signal chips that process audio signals (analog and digital signals, for both analog and digital data).

What is FM music production?

Frequency modulation synthesis (or FM synthesis) is a form of sound synthesis whereby the frequency of a waveform is changed by modulating its frequency with a modulator. Digital FM synthesis (implemented as phase modulation) was the basis of several musical instruments beginning as early as 1974.
